Output 353685a503dcab285ea75a5f5a78e3897117ca60d8078079c9a85e083f78f4b6:1

value
560498
script pubkey
OP_0 OP_PUSHBYTES_20 ca0d8cea2fc038bdaf96cb78d942c30e5f43bb84
address
bc1qegxce630cqutmtukedudjskrpe058wuydy2s24
transaction
353685a503dcab285ea75a5f5a78e3897117ca60d8078079c9a85e083f78f4b6
confirmations
172472
spent
true